Presuming in React – A React Quick guide

Several React consumers credit report analysis Believing in React as the moment when it ultimately clicked on for all of them. However, prior to you may dive into this publication, you have to first know a handful of qualification technologies.

React is constantly progressing, along with the very most latest launch being React 18. Remaining current on brand new components empowers programmers to create more feature-rich and also straightforward treatments. guide

Getting going
React is a front-end library for making user interfaces (UI) in web applications. It is a JavaScript-based platform created as well as discharged by Facebook. It is more straightforward than other platforms, including jQuery or Vue, and it gives components like dynamically including UI components. It also assists other modern technologies, like Redux and GraphQL.

To start along with React, you need to have to mount it on your computer system and configure your venture environments. As soon as you have actually performed this, you can easily create an essential React app by generating a brand new report called index.html in your task directory. This report will definitely be utilized to present your React application. You must be actually knowledgeable that React is actually a JavaScript-based platform, and it demands you to use some familiar JavaScript concepts. For instance, you will certainly need to understand principles like elements, parts, props, and also condition.

React is actually an adaptable as well as powerful platform that permits you to generate intricate interfaces for your apps. Nonetheless, it could be complicated to learn if you aren’t aware of the ideas behind it. To receive a much better understanding of React, you ought to consider taking a course from an internet understanding provider, like freeCodeCamp’s React Amateur’s Course for 2022. This program will instruct you exactly how to utilize React, as well as you’ll acquire a total understanding of the ideas that are necessary for creating individual interfaces with React.

Generating a Standard App
Respond is actually a collection made use of to generate customer interfaces for internet applications. It is actually a structure that enables programmers to handle information that can transform as time go on, and it supports powerful page updates without must reload the entire web site. React is actually light-weight as well as scalable, as well as it divides interface elements coming from use logic. This approach produces it less complicated to maintain code, and also it decreases the risk of insects in the UI.

Respond has actually acquired attraction one of internet and also front-end creators as a result of its own reusability as well as component-based architecture. It has an explanatory phrase structure that supplies programmers along with devices to illustrate exactly how the UI ought to seem in unique conditions. This helps minimize the amount of pests that can occur during the course of user interface progression and also makes certain that the end product matches the style. It likewise sustains a stateless leaving version, which boosts performance and enables creators to focus on establishing multiple-use components.

In React, a developer may develop a general app in about one minute. To get going, incorporate the center React collection API from a CDN to your site’s HTML mark documents. You must additionally include Babel, which transpiles React code to make certain cross-browser compatibility. You may likewise use create-react-app, which streamlines the arrangement procedure by taking care of a frontend create pipe and providing an out-of-the-box UI template.

You may likewise utilize an internet code playing field to evaluate out React. These internet sites will automatically update as you produce modifications to the source code.

Generating a Static Application
Although React is mainly used for powerful internet requests, it can likewise be used to create stationary internet sites. In reality, several sizable firms including Mailchimp and also Slack use React for merely that purpose.

Respond makes use of a style language named JSX, which is a combination of HTML as well as JavaScript. While some developers object to the complexity of JSX, it is actually simple to learn as well as can easily help you produce more instinctive and readable code. It likewise permits you to develop interface extra quickly and simply than making use of HTML alone.

To utilize React to build a fixed application, you need to first install the necessary public libraries. You can possibly do this through making use of npm, a command-line device that packages and creates JavaScript uses. npm installs the React library as well as any type of reliances, consisting of Babel, a tool that enhances as well as bunches JavaScript reports.

When you prepare to release your React app, operate npm construct, which are going to generate an enhanced create of the app. This create may after that be posted to your holding service of choice.

To lessen the quantity of changeable state, you should make an effort to identify the minimum collection of tangible information that your function requires. At that point, pinpoint the part that has this information and also pass it down to its little one parts with props. This helps guarantee that each component possesses a single responsibility and also lessens code copying.

Making a Mobile App
React Native is an open-source structure that lets you develop cross-platform mobile phone apps. It supports iphone and Android and gives components that may access native platform components. You can easily likewise use APIs to store and get information and also confirm users. Once you’ve created your app, you can utilize Xcode or even Android Center to build and also archive it for distribution.

Respond has a quite small API, that makes it exciting and simple to learn. Nonetheless, it’s not acquainted, thus there is a discovering curve. It’s greatest to start by making use of a little React instance and also then relocating on to more sophisticated examples. This will definitely aid you recognize the concepts a lot better.

You may discover several examples on the React homepage, featuring an online editor. It is actually ideal to utilize a code publisher that sustains JavaScript, like Aesthetic Workshop Code (very recommended), Sublime Text, or even Atom. The React information is additionally a good resource of info. The glossary is a great place to begin, as it has a list of terms and their interpretations. The API endorsement may offer even more in-depth details concerning React’s lifecycle approaches.

Respond is practical as well as driven through the necessities of the products it is actually made use of in. While it is actually determined through some ideals that are certainly not yet conventional, including practical programming, maintaining React obtainable to a large range of developers is actually an explicit goal of the task.

Leave a Reply

Your email address will not be published. Required fields are marked *